    So I started working on the 8 of pentacles. Here's the card descrip: http://www.learntarot.com/p8.htm Basically, dilligence, hard work and attention to detail is the meaning. Since it's of the pentacles (earth) suit, it usually has to deal with crafting. It was pretty hard to think of anything better than "alien repairs something" but eventually I came up with the idea that the development of those super-efficient chlorophyll plates I was talking about could have possibly solved an energy crisis they had in the past. The image turned into a dedicated scientist working to develop those plates. Here's where I'm at and a short description:

    “We faced the sixth energy crisis in the same amount of decades. Fossil fuels were finite, fusion was impractical at smaller scales, and our entire way of life - made possible only by our power suits - was seemingly coming to an end. Mran Dalla refused to lose concentration, however. Her diligence lost her her friends, her mate, even her status as a scientist. In the end, she developed a new molecule called atraphyll - an incredibly efficient, nearly black version of chlorophyll able to absorb energy from even the green portions of the EM spectrum. Weaved onto standard energy plates, they powered our suits with ease. She drew her inspiration for the earth, and we all draw our inspiration from her.”
